Toronto exercised Jason Grilli’s option for next season:

The Royals and Danny Duffy opened extension talks.

Here’s the latest from around the American League Central.

Cleveland named a pair of assistant general managers Saturday, according to Jordan Bastian of MLB.com.

Greg Holland is receiving a significant amount of interest, and the Yankees and the Red Sox are involved:

The Mets, Giants, Nationals and Blue Jays could emerge as the favorites for Yoenis Cespedes, according to Mike Puma of the New York Post.

San Diego might not believe in qualifying offers:

Kansas City declined Luke Hochevar’s option, the club announced Saturday.
